Price Performance
See More| Period | Period Low | Period High | Performance | |
|---|---|---|---|---|
| 1-Month | 29.4361 +4.08% on 04/02/26 | | 37.0186 -17.24% on 03/17/26 | -1.9980 (-6.12%) since 03/06/26 |
| 3-Month | 29.4361 +4.08% on 04/02/26 | | 96.4204 -68.22% on 01/16/26 | -13.7565 (-30.99%) since 01/06/26 |
| 52-Week | 17.4726 +75.35% on 06/23/25 | | 149.7607 -79.54% on 11/04/25 | +8.9240 (+41.10%) since 04/04/25 |